Web26 sep. 2024 · Pour the paint stripper into a pump sprayer. Spray the paint stripper over the entire surface of the painted and stained log home. Let the paint stripper sit for 24 hours or according to the manufacturer. During this time, keep children and pets away from the log cabin. As the stripper works you will notice the paint slowly peel away from the wood. Web7 jan. 2024 · To remove mold and mildew from your house: Mix up a solution of 1 part bleach to 10 parts water and spray in a pump up sprayer. Allow to remain on for 10-20 minutes, then rinse using a garden hose. Mix up a solution of TSP in a bucket, following the directions on the box.

Web21 aug. 2024 · STEP 1. To remove deck stain from vinyl siding, start by mixing one cup powdered oxygen bleach with a gallon of water. These two materials may be combined in a bucket. Transfer the solution to a spray bottle after shaking.
